The saturated zone, a zone in which all the pores and rock fractures are filled with water, underlies the unsaturated zone. The top of the saturated zone is called the water table (Diagram 1). The water table may be just below or hundreds of feet below the land surface. kwi maritim.de

WebProperties of saturated water. Temp. T, °C. Note 1: Kinematic viscosity 𝜈 and thermal diffusivity 𝛼 can be calculated from their definitions, 𝜈 = 𝜇/𝜌 and 𝛼 = k/𝜌c _p p = 𝜈 /Pr. The temperatures 0.01°C, 100°C, and 374.14°C are the triple-, boiling-, and critical-point temperatures of water, respectively.
